uv Quick Start
Install uv
curl -LsSf https://astral.sh/uv/install.sh | sh
Windows: powershell -c "irm https://astral.sh/uv/install.ps1 | iex"
Create project
uv init my-project cd my-project
Add dependencies
uv add fastapi pydantic uv add --dev pytest ruff mypy
Run commands
uv run python main.py uv run pytest
Sync dependencies from lock
uv sync
uv Commands Cheatsheet
Command Description
uv init
Create new project
uv add <pkg>
Add dependency
uv add --dev <pkg>
Add dev dependency
uv remove <pkg>
Remove dependency
uv sync
Install from lockfile
uv lock
Update lockfile
uv run <cmd>
Run in venv
uv pip install
pip-compatible install
uv python install 3.12
Install Python version
uv tool install ruff
Install global tool
uvx ruff check .
Run tool without install
pyproject.toml (PEP 621)
[project] name = "my-project" version = "1.0.0" description = "Project description" readme = "README.md" license = {text = "MIT"} requires-python = ">=3.10" authors = [ {name = "Your Name", email = "you@example.com"} ]
dependencies = [ "fastapi>=0.115.0", "pydantic>=2.0", "sqlalchemy>=2.0", ]
[project.optional-dependencies] dev = [ "pytest>=8.0", "pytest-asyncio>=0.23", "pytest-cov>=4.0", "ruff>=0.14", "mypy>=1.0", ]
[project.scripts] my-cli = "my_project.cli:main"
[build-system] requires = ["hatchling"] build-backend = "hatchling.build"
[tool.uv] dev-dependencies = [ "pytest>=8.0", "ruff>=0.14", ]

Dependency Versioning
Exact version
"package==1.2.3"
Minimum version (recommended for apps)
"package>=1.2.0"
Compatible release (recommended for libraries)
"package>=1.2,<2.0" "package~=1.2" # Same as >=1.2,<2.0
Exclude versions
"package>=1.0,!=1.5.0"

Project Structure (src Layout)
my-project/ ├── src/ │ └── my_package/ │ ├── init.py │ ├── main.py │ └── core.py ├── tests/ │ ├── init.py │ └── test_core.py ├── pyproject.toml ├── uv.lock └── README.md
Benefits of src layout:
-
Tests run against installed package
-
Prevents accidental imports from cwd
-
Cleaner package distribution
Anti-Patterns
Anti-Pattern Why It's Bad Solution
No lockfile Non-reproducible builds Always commit lockfile
pip freeze > requirements.txt
Includes transitive deps Use proper tool (uv, poetry)
Global pip installs Version conflicts Always use virtual environments
Pinning to exact versions everywhere Hard to update Use ranges for libraries
Not separating dev dependencies Bloated production Use optional-dependencies or groups
